SSH KEY LOGIN:修订间差异
更多语言
更多操作
无编辑摘要 |
无编辑摘要 |
||
| (未显示4个用户的13个中间版本) | |||
| 第1行: | 第1行: | ||
视频教学:https://youtu.be/gVsfSpjcwus | |||
<youtube>gVsfSpjcwus</youtube> | |||
[[File: | === 第一步:生成密钥对 === | ||
打开并下载安装 putty key Generator | |||
下载地址:https://the.earth.li/~sgtatham/putty/latest/wa64/putty-arm64-0.83-installer.msi | |||
[[File:Ssh密钥对6.png]] | |||
生成了一个公钥,待会需要粘贴到搬瓦工服务器上,请复制下来 | 生成了一个公钥,待会需要粘贴到搬瓦工服务器上,请复制下来 | ||
[[File:Ssh.png]] | [[File:Ssh密钥对7.png]] | ||
保存私钥到你本地的文件夹,待会登录搬瓦工的时候需要用到 | 保存私钥到你本地的文件夹,待会登录搬瓦工的时候需要用到 | ||
登 | === 第二步:修改服务器上公钥 === | ||
登录 ssh,输入以下命令: | |||
cd /root/.ssh (ssh前面有个.) | <code>cd /root/.ssh</code> ( ssh前面有个 <code>.</code> ) | ||
nano authorized_keys | <code>nano authorized_keys</code> | ||
这时候,在nano编辑界面,粘贴刚才第一步产生的公钥(技巧, | 这时候,在nano编辑界面,粘贴刚才第一步产生的公钥(技巧,在 '''putty key generator''' 上复制好公钥,在 vps 的 nano 界面右键点击黑色空白位置,公钥就被粘贴进去了) | ||
[[ | [[File:Ssh密钥对2.png]] | ||
这时候按ctrl + x,选择Y ,再按回车 | 这时候按ctrl + x,选择Y ,再按回车 | ||
cd /etc/ssh | === 第三步:关闭密码登录,开启密钥登录 === | ||
输入以下命令: | |||
<code>cd /etc/ssh</code> | |||
nano sshd_config | <code>nano sshd_config</code> | ||
在 nano 界面,将 | |||
<nowiki>#</nowiki>PubkeyAuthentication yes | <code><nowiki>#</nowiki>PubkeyAuthentication yes</code> | ||
<nowiki>#</nowiki>PasswordAuthentication yes | <code><nowiki>#</nowiki>PasswordAuthentication yes</code> | ||
前面的#删除,并 | 前面的<code>#</code>删除,并将<code>PasswordAuthentication yes</code>改为<code>no</code> | ||
修改完结果如下: | 修改完结果如下: | ||
[[File:修改后结果1.png]] | |||
[[File: | |||
这时候按 ctrl + x,选择 Y ,再按回车 | |||
=== 第四步:重启 sshd 服务 === | |||
输入以下命令: | |||
<code>systemctl restart sshd</code> | |||
第五步:重新登录 ssh,并选择私钥 | |||
[[File:Ssh密钥对3.png]] | |||
选择你的私钥 | |||
[[File:Ssh密钥对4.png]] | |||
[[File:Ssh密钥对5.png]] | |||
按顺序点击:4 Session → 5 Save → 6 Open,就可以用私钥登录你的服务器[[File:私钥成功.png]] | |||
至此,使用密钥登录,可以解决 99.99% 的暴力扫描和破解的可能性;下篇文章写一下如何修改 ssh 端口为高位端口。 | |||
{{DEFAULTSORT:SSH Key Login}}教程来自搬瓦工交流群:https://t.me/bwh81 | |||
[[Category:300 VPS 设置与管理 — VPS Setup and Management]] | |||
2025年12月2日 (二) 15:29的最新版本
视频教学:https://youtu.be/gVsfSpjcwus
第一步:生成密钥对
打开并下载安装 putty key Generator
下载地址:https://the.earth.li/~sgtatham/putty/latest/wa64/putty-arm64-0.83-installer.msi
生成了一个公钥,待会需要粘贴到搬瓦工服务器上,请复制下来
保存私钥到你本地的文件夹,待会登录搬瓦工的时候需要用到
第二步:修改服务器上公钥
登录 ssh,输入以下命令:
cd /root/.ssh ( ssh前面有个 . )
nano authorized_keys
这时候,在nano编辑界面,粘贴刚才第一步产生的公钥(技巧,在 putty key generator 上复制好公钥,在 vps 的 nano 界面右键点击黑色空白位置,公钥就被粘贴进去了)
这时候按ctrl + x,选择Y ,再按回车
第三步:关闭密码登录,开启密钥登录
输入以下命令:
cd /etc/ssh
nano sshd_config
在 nano 界面,将
#PubkeyAuthentication yes
#PasswordAuthentication yes
前面的#删除,并将PasswordAuthentication yes改为no
修改完结果如下:
这时候按 ctrl + x,选择 Y ,再按回车
第四步:重启 sshd 服务
输入以下命令:
systemctl restart sshd
第五步:重新登录 ssh,并选择私钥
选择你的私钥
按顺序点击:4 Session → 5 Save → 6 Open,就可以用私钥登录你的服务器
至此,使用密钥登录,可以解决 99.99% 的暴力扫描和破解的可能性;下篇文章写一下如何修改 ssh 端口为高位端口。
教程来自搬瓦工交流群:https://t.me/bwh81






